2 women indicted for December homicide in Hamilton

Two women have been indicted by a Butler County grand jury for the death of a man shot in Hamilton late last year.

Jamie Strack and Chelsea N. Bussell are both charged with involuntary manslaughter and kidnapping for the Dec. 17 shooting death of Brandon York, according to court records.

York, 30, of the 600 block of Concord Avenue in Middletown, died at Bethesda Butler Hospital after suffering a gunshot wound. His death was ruled a homicide by the Butler County Coroner’s Office.

Investigators determined an incident occurred in the area of 12th and Hanover streets in Hamilton. In December, police said they had persons of interest in the shooting.

Detectives served search warrants connected to the case in the city’s North End, including the area of Vine Street, shortly after the shooting that involved the SWAT team.

Bussell, 26, of Star Avenue in Hamilton, was booked into the Butler County Jail on Wednesday night. Strack, of Meadowview Court in Fairfield, is not yet in custody, according to jail records
